About this course

Through this course, learners gain an in-depth understanding of the latest trends and techniques in environmental journalism. They acquire skills in researching environmental stories, interviewing experts, and writing compelling articles that engage and inform readers. The course also covers the ethical considerations of environmental journalism and how to report on controversial issues fairly and accurately. By completing this course, learners will be well-positioned to pursue careers in environmental journalism or related fields. They will have a solid foundation in the principles and practices of environmental journalism and the skills to report on emerging trends in the field.

Course Details

• Environmental Policy & Regulations
• Climate Change Science & Communication
• Biodiversity & Conservation Journalism
• Data Journalism & Environmental Data Analysis
• Ethics in Environmental Journalism
• Emerging Trends in Renewable Energy
• Environmental Justice & Social Equity
• Sustainable Development Goals & Reporting
• Interviewing Techniques for Environmental Journalists
• Multimedia Storytelling in Environmental Journalism
